English
Etymology
From inter- + generation + -al.
Pronunciation
Adjective
intergenerational (not comparable)
- Between or across generations.
- intergenerational justice
- 2021 May 19, Donna M. Owens, “Microaggressions and straight-up racism are exhausting Black people”, in Racial Reckoning, NBC News, retrieved 5 May 2025:
- In nearly 300 pages, the book delves into the history of white supremacy and racist systems that have led to intergenerational Black fatigue.
